Pamporovo offers extremely good value for money and is probably one of the best places in the world to learn to ski. Pamporovo ski resort is spread across the beautiful Snezhanka Mountain.  It is particularly ideal for beginners and children yet has enough challenging runs to keep the advanced skier happy for more than a few days. Complete beginners will spend the first couple of days on the nursery slopes, learning the basics, but will very quickly progress and will make their way up the mountain.  Once the basics are mastered, the long green run goes from the tower at the top all the way back down, meaning that all of the Snezhanka peak is accessible.  The runs to Stoikite are the next challenge but a gentle blue and red give you a steady progression in comfort. Snow canons are in abudance meaning that ski-ing is pretty much guaranteed during the whole season.  We can arrange ski equipment, lift passes and tuition for you at a fraction of the cost of other ski resorts - Pamporovo has a cost of living of around a third of other European ski resorts.  There are excellent ski schools, with English speaking instructors, reasonably priced restaurants.

Set amongst magnificent pine forests, Pamporovo has a unique claim to fame – this bright, modern ski resort is the sunniest and one of the most popular mountain resorts in Europe.  It boasts no less than 270 sunny days a year on average, and in the winter provides an ideal combination – plenty of snow (average snow depth of 140 – 150cm) and plenty of sparkling sunshine to show off the resort at its best.  Being an all year round holiday resort, summer temperatures range from 20 - 30c. The area has no history of major avalanches or violet changes in the weather making it a safe and relaxing place for ski, snowboard, cross country, ski or snow hike.  There are 13 ski lifts in the resort (6 chair lifts and 7 tows) which serve the 18 ski slopes. It also has a state of the art ski lift, being the only one of its kind on the Balkan Peninsula and ranked second in Europe.  This lift has enabled the ski season to be extended by using the wonderful conditions of ski tracks on the northern slopes and now takes the total length of ski tracks to 25km!

Nestled in the heart of the Rhodope Mountains, set within a beautiful Nature Reserve, this beautiful region is said to have once been the home of Orpheus.  

In the resort itself, Pamporovo offers a whole host of contemporary bars, restaurants, shops and other facilities catering for the every need of the tourist.  Most of them offer free transport and will come to the village to collect you and return you when you are ready to leave.  Nearby is the very picturesque town of Smolyan, very cosmopolitan with a whole array of restaurants, trendy bars, shops, boutiques and leisure facilities to cater for everyone.

SUMMER.  During the summer months the beautiful countryside surrounding the Pamporovo area is certainly worth a visit.  After the snow white mountains of the Bulgarian winter, the lush green of the mountains and pine trees provide a startling and beautiful contrast.  The snow covered pistes are replaced by spring flowers on lush green grass, ski-doos and sledges are replaced by horses, 4x4 vehicles and mountain bikes circuits.  There are many summer activities on offer including mountain biking, horse riding, fishing, cycling, hunting, alpine climbing, swimming, bowling, outdoor paintballing, quad biking, white water rafting, nature walks, boating, visiting monasteries, churches, bird watching, visiting spa centres, barbecues, zip wires, caving, and jeep safari - there is literally something for everyone.  You will see photographs of the attractions you can visit on the site.  Guests also make this a two-centre holiday as within a 60-90 minute drive you can enjoy the luxury of a beach holiday with the beautiful Greek beaches that are on offer.  Photographs are also shown on the site.
